Join us to shape a dynamic Azure-based Treasury landscape for NIBC and make your mark in our Treasury business domain!

Job Description

What will you do?

As our Product Owner, you hold a key role in maximizing the value delivered by the Treasury IT delivery team. You will collaborate closely with the Business Owner of Treasury Operations to turn business demands into strategic roadmaps, detailing initiatives and domain roadmaps as epics, which you will then guide into the team backlog as user stories. As the team's primary advocate, you align business and technology strategies, empowering the team to balance multiple stakeholder needs while consistently evolving solutions.

Main Responsibilities

  • Craft and maintain a product vision and roadmap for both run and change activities, drawing from market insights and IT trends;
  • Manage and prioritize the Team Backlog based on value, and guide epics from the Domain Backlog into the Team Backlog;
  • Ensure the team only works on 'ready' epics, acting as a safeguard;
  • Act as sparring partner for the team ensuring the solutions follow the best practices for Front Arena, the main Treasury system of NIBC;
  • Collaborate with stakeholders, such as the Business Owner, Domain Architect, IT Manager, and Transformation Office, valuing all perspectives while setting priorities based on value;
  • Support the Delivery Team in maximizing value delivery through tools and automated solutions, and clearly articulate the items on the Team Backlog;
  • Grasp the critical success factors for NIBC, including the context and dependencies of the product;
  • Actively contribute to the Product Owner Center of Expertise and Agile Center of Expertise;
  • Coordinate release plans with key stakeholders and other teams when dependencies exist, while incorporating team estimations;
  • Regularly engage with stakeholders to refine and validate product progress and future directions, and lead Sprint Review meetings;
  • Ensure transparency of the Team Backlog to the team and stakeholders, keeping them informed about team and product delivery progress;
  • Proactively drive improvements on KPIs, such as engagement, productivity, quality, time to market, and value, to continuously enhance team performance;
  • Conduct non-functional controls on the IT product or service delivered by the team.

Your Challenge

In 2024, we expanded the Agile Way-of-Working (WoW) to include the business side by appointing Business Owners (BO's) who gather all functional needs and demands for their respective business domains. Each IT team now has a dedicated Product Owner and Scrum Master. You will join the Treasury IT delivery team, which is responsible for managing the IT landscape that supports the Treasury domain. Alongside the Scrum Master and the team, you will work to enhance the team’s maturity. Currently, the team is focused on migrating the main Treasury application, Front Arena, to our Azure Cloud landing zone. Following this, the team will participate in the restructuring of the funding process of our Retail mortgages and in optimizing the implementation and fully leveraging the benefits offered by the Azure Cloud environment.

Your team

Step into a pivotal role as the Product Owner for our Treasury IT delivery team at NIBC. This dynamic team is at the heart of managing the IT landscape for our Treasury business domain, where we provide essential Treasury products and expertly manage the bank's liquidity.

As PO you will become part of the broader Corporate Banking IT team. Within the Corporate Banking IT team, the following teams are present: the Asset Based Finance IT team, the Payments IT team and the Treasury IT team. Also working in the Corporate Banking IT team is a IT Service Manager. You will report to the domain IT manager for Corporate Banking & Treasury IT.

What do you bring?

Our ideal candidate is a proactive and collaborative Product Owner with:

  • A Bachelor’s or Master’s degree, or comparably relevant working experience;
  • 5+ years of relevant working experience with Agile of which at least 3+ years as a Product Owner in the Banking industry, or another heavily regulated industry;
  • Preferably experience with and knowledge of Treasury business functions/products and Treasury systems like Front Arena;
  • Preferably experience in IT in a role responsible for run and change/development;
  • Knowledge of IT related banking regulations and relevant IT standards and best practices;
  • High level of initiative, ownership and self-motivation, with the ability work in a team environment;
  • Great communication skills; fluent in English written and verbal. Proficiency in Dutch is an advantage;
  • Knowledge and experience with Agile/Scrum is required;
  • Professional Scrum Product Owner (PSPO)/Certified Scrum Product Owner;
  • Professional Scrum Product Owner – Advanced (PSPO-A);
  • Knowledge and experience with SAFe is preferred.
